Technical Field
The invention relates to a method for monitoring yarns of a spinning machine based on longitudinal width distribution, and belongs to the technical field of textile electronics.
Background
The seamless underwear machine is special molding production equipment for producing seamless knitwear, and can be used for making underwear, swimwear, sportswear and the like. Statistics show that in 2010, seamless knitting and traditional knitting respectively account for 40% and 60% of the global knitted underwear market. The current seamless underwear machine realizes the complete weaving of one piece of clothing without human intervention, has high working efficiency and greatly reduces the production cost. Seamless underwear can be woven by multiple groups or even more than ten groups of yarns, even if one group of yarns is broken or lack of yarns, which leads to the scrapping of the currently woven clothes. Therefore, monitoring of yarn breakage and yarn shortage is particularly important. The currently used yarn state sensor uses a differential infrared photodiode to detect. The mode has the advantages of simple principle and low cost, but the gain of the amplifying circuit is very large and is easy to be interfered, and the detection area is very narrow and has high installation requirements. With the large number of applications of image detection, the prices of image sensors and image processors are greatly reduced, and image processing technologies are more and more mature. Thus, yarn condition detection based on image analysis becomes possible.

Detailed Description
The invention will now be further described with reference to the accompanying drawings in which:
referring to fig. 1-2, a method for monitoring yarns of a spinning machine based on longitudinal width distribution comprises a U-shaped shell and an electronic control device arranged in the shell, wherein the electronic control device comprises a power circuit for providing power, a processor for performing operation processing, an infrared emission unit 1 and an image sensor 2 which are connected with the processor, and an infrared filter 3 is arranged on the image sensor 2.
The power supply circuit performs level conversion on an input power supply, stabilizes voltage and provides power for other circuits.
The image sensor 2 is configured as a CCD linear image sensor or a CMOS linear image sensor sensitive to infrared rays, and the processor can read image data as needed.
The yarn state identification method is arranged in the processor, can detect the motion state and the static state of the yarn, and comprises the following steps:
(1) every fixed period T, the processor collects the image data output by the image sensorf t(x, y), x = 1-M, y = 1-N, wherein M is the maximum pixel number in the x-axis direction, and N is the maximum pixel number in the y-axis direction;
in step (1), the processor 1 samples every fixed period T to obtain an image sequence of a two-dimensional matrixf t(x,y),f t-1(x,y),f t-2(x,y),.....
(2) Adopting a binarization algorithm to image dataf t(x, y) performing binarization processing to obtain a binary functiony t(x, y), and the projected area of the yarny t(x, y) =1, non-projection areay t(x,y)=0;
(3) Along the y-axis direction, counting a binary functiony tThe width of the projection area of (x, y) to obtain an array Wt[N]Wherein W ist[i]=,i=1~N;
Thus array Wt[N]The width of the yarn projection area or the yarn in the longitudinal direction is described, the characteristics of the yarn are reflected, and state recognition can be carried out.
(4) Calculating the currently acquired array Wt[N]W collected from the previous timet-1[N]The difference S of (a): when S is larger than or equal to a preset threshold value K, judging that the yarn is in a motion state; and when the S is smaller than a preset threshold value K, judging that the yarn is in a static state.
In step (4), the currently acquired array W is acquiredt[N]W collected from the previous timet-1[N]The calculation method of the difference S comprises the following steps: s =。
And judging according to the principle that the difference S is close to zero when the yarn is static.
